Becher says they are north of 12K for the draft party. He says the record for a draft party was around 5K for Bedard in Chicago last year. #SJSharks
Becher says the #SJSharks had a record sales number in tickets in May and is tracking for something similar in June.
Grier says he did speak with Marco Sturm, but says reports that he was a finalist are not accurate. #SJSharks
